Contracts
Distribution
Bridge
Website
Electra Protocol Blockchain, Multi Layer Explorer
Search
Supply:
18,339,497,477
Lastest Block:
1,987,597
Utxos:
1,985,177
Nodes:
361
OmniXEP Contracts:
279
Block details
[STAKE]
11/03/2025 22:01:04 UTC
Txid
e8264406c8adb6b26c8abffbe77acb450aaef2fc41957a914e84e01061f584d9
Block
1,659,178
Block hash
878211a4143bd0a334d582348c08edf722219c974dd34fd4eb8126fc88cfd47e
Stake amount
2,027.23038413 XEP
Sender
ep1q42q9qfnm2eh6xyzjf0sa95892fmll9vl52yled
Recipient
ep1q42q9qfnm2eh6xyzjf0sa95892fmll9vl52yled
(2,237,064.35510372 XEP)